A Perfect Symbiotic Relationship

Salmon, often referred to as "the lifeblood of the Northwest," play a pivotal role in sustaining not only the population of wolves but also a host of other wildlife species in the region. Every year, thousands of these incredible fish embark on an awe-inspiring journey, swimming upstream against powerful currents to return to their ancestral spawning grounds.

As the salmon make their way upstream, the strong aroma of their flesh pervades the air, creating a captivating olfactory trail for the wolves. With an exceptional sense of smell, the wolves are drawn to the rivers teeming with salmon. The abundance of this nutrient-rich prey ensures that the wolves have a consistent food source, particularly during the spawning season.

But it's not just the wolves that benefit from this symbiotic relationship. The wolves play a crucial role in regulating the salmon population. By preying on the weaker or diseased salmon, they contribute to the overall health and genetic diversity of the species. Through the timeless dance between predator and prey, nature ensures that the ecosystem remains balanced and resilient.

Navigating a Changing Landscape

The land of salmon is not without its challenges, and as with any ecosystem, it is not immune to change. Environmental factors such as climate change can significantly impact the availability of salmon, disrupting the delicate balance of predator-prey relationships that sustain the wolves.

As the salmon population faces threats from rising temperatures and habitat destruction, the wolves must adapt to these changes or face dire consequences. In recent years, researchers have noted behavioral modifications in the wolves, including altered hunting patterns and increased interactions with humans.

Conservation Efforts

Recognizing the importance of wolves in maintaining a healthy ecosystem, various conservation organizations and government agencies have dedicated resources to protect and restore the populations of these magnificent creatures.

Efforts include educational programs to raise awareness about the vital role wolves play in the ecosystem, implementing measures to mitigate human-wolf conflicts, and promoting sustainable fishing practices to ensure the availability of salmon as a food source for the wolves.

Long considered an icon of the wild, wolves capture our imagination and spark controversy. Humans are the adult wolf’s only true natural predator; its return to the old-growth forests and wild coastlines of the Pacific Northwest renews age-old questions about the value of wildlands and wildlife.
    
As the vivid stories unfold in this riveting and timely book, wolves emerge as smart, complex players uniquely adapted to the vast interdependent ecosystem of this stunning region. Observing them at close range, David Moskowitz explores how they live, hunt, and communicate, tracing their biology and ecology through firsthand encounters in the wildlands of the Northwest. In the process he challenges assumptions about their role and the impact of even well-meaning human interventions.
